Concrete achievements in 2018 to ensure the protection of refugee and migrant children

The Special Representative is taking stock on concrete results achieved in 2018 in the implementation of the Council of Europe Action Plan on protecting migrant and refugee children in Europe (2017-2019). Today, he publishes a visual presentation of all actions achieved so far in protecting children in migration, including the relevant resources linked to the results.

The Special Representative acknowledges the commitment and joint efforts of the different units dealing with migration at the Council of Europe. He extends his thanks to Andorra, Belgium, Czech Republic, Hungary, Italy, Liechtenstein, Monaco and Serbia who contributed financially in the implementation of the Action Plan. He also expressed appreciation to Switzerland for the voluntary contributions to the PACE Campaign End Immigration Detention of Children and to Azerbaijan, Germany, Norway, San Marino, and the European Union for their voluntary contributions to projects covered jointly under the Action Plan on Building Inclusive Societies.

The activities carried out under the Action Plan have a special focus on unaccompanied and separated children aiming at ensuring access to rights and child-friendly procedures, providing effective protection from violence and enhancing integration of children who would remain in Europe.

In September 2018, the Special Representative presented the mid-term review of the implementation of the Action Plan in a narrative report.
